Commit ee1113f7 authored by caixingbing's avatar caixingbing

*

parent 4c16ba73
......@@ -53,7 +53,7 @@
</template>
</el-table>
</div>
<div class="pagination-box">
<div class="pagination-box" v-if="paging">
<el-pagination background :current-page="queryParams.pageNum" :page-size="queryParams.pageSize" :total="tableDataTotal" layout="prev, pager, next, jumper" @current-change="handleCurrentChange" @size-change="handleSizeChange" />
</div>
</div>
......@@ -91,6 +91,10 @@ export default {
type: Object,
default: {}
},
paging: {
type: Boolean,
default: true
},
},
data() {
return {
......
......@@ -5,16 +5,72 @@
<el-tab-pane label="工商变更" name="second"></el-tab-pane>
</el-tabs>
<div v-if="activeName=='first'">
111
<div class="businfo-box" v-if="activeName=='first'">
<p>
<label class="label">企业名称</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">社会信用代码</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">法定代表人</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">登记状态</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">成立日期</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">注册资本</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">实缴资本</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">核准日期</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">组织机构代码</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">工商注册号</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">纳税人识别号</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">企业类型</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">营业期限</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">纳税人资质</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">所属地区</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">登记机关</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">人员规模</label>
<span>{{forInfo.companyName || '--'}}</span>
<label class="label">参保人数</label>
<span>{{forInfo.companyName || '--'}}</span>
</p>
<p>
<label class="label">经营范围</label>
<span class="span-one">{{forInfo.companyName || '--'}}</span>
</p>
</div>
<tables
:tableLoading="tableLoading"
:tableData="tableData"
:forData="forData"
:tableDataTotal="tableDataTotal"
:queryParams="queryParams"
@handle-current-change="handleCurrentChange"
:paging="false"
v-if="activeName=='second'"
/>
</div>
......@@ -24,6 +80,7 @@
import mixin from '../mixins/mixin'
export default {
name: 'Businfo',
props: ['companyId'],
mixins: [mixin],
data() {
return {
......@@ -33,29 +90,26 @@ export default {
pageNum: 1,
pageSize: 10
},
forInfo: {},
forData: [
{label: '变更日期', prop: 'inReason', slot: true},
{label: '变更日期', prop: 'inReason', width: '90', slot: true},
{label: '变更事项', prop: 'inDate'},
{label: '变更前', prop: 'department'},
{label: '变更后', prop: 'department'}
],
formData: [],
//列表
tableLoading:false,
tableData:[],
pageIndex:1,
pageSize:10,
tableDataTotal:0,
tableData:[]
}
},
created() {
this.dataRegion()
this.handleData()
},
methods: {
handleClick(){
this.dataRegion()
this.handleData()
},
async dataRegion() {
async handleData() {
this.tableData = [
{id:1, inReason:'达萨法达萨法', inDate:'000',tag:'aaa'},
{id:2, inReason:'达萨法达萨法', inDate:'111'},
......@@ -90,5 +144,35 @@ export default {
}
}
}
.businfo-box {
border-top: 1px solid #E6E9F0;
p {
display: flex;
align-items: center;
margin: 0;
border-left: 1px solid #E6E9F0;
border-bottom: 1px solid #E6E9F0;
.label {
width: 10%;
font-weight: 400;
line-height: 40px;
font-size: 12px;
height: 40px;
background: #F0F3FA;
padding-left: 12px;
}
span {
width: 40%;
color: #000;
height: 40px;
line-height: 40px;
padding-left: 12px;
font-size: 12px;
}
.span-one {
width: 90%;
}
}
}
}
</style>
......@@ -5,16 +5,14 @@
:form-data="formData"
:query-params="queryParams"
:total="tableDataTotal"
@handle-search="handleSearch"
/>
<tables
:tableLoading="tableLoading"
:tableData="tableData"
:forData="forData"
:tableDataTotal="tableDataTotal"
:queryParams="queryParams"
@handle-current-change="handleCurrentChange"
:paging="false"
/>
</div>
</template>
......@@ -23,6 +21,7 @@
import mixin from '../mixins/mixin'
export default {
name: 'Execuinfo',
props: ['companyId'],
mixins: [mixin],
data() {
return {
......@@ -39,16 +38,14 @@ export default {
//列表
tableLoading:false,
tableData:[],
pageIndex:1,
pageSize:10,
tableDataTotal:0,
}
},
created() {
this.dataRegion()
this.handleData()
},
methods: {
async dataRegion() {
async handleData() {
this.tableData = [
{id:1, inReason:'达萨法达萨法', inDate:'000',tag:'aaa'},
{id:2, inReason:'达萨法达萨法', inDate:'111'},
......
......@@ -5,7 +5,6 @@
:form-data="formData"
:query-params="queryParams"
:total="tableDataTotal"
@handle-search="handleSearch"
/>
<el-tabs v-model="activeName" @tab-click="handleClick" class="detail-tab">
<el-tab-pane label="股东信息" name="first"></el-tab-pane>
......@@ -35,6 +34,7 @@
import mixin from '../mixins/mixin'
export default {
name: 'Holderinfo',
props: ['companyId'],
mixins: [mixin],
data() {
return {
......@@ -50,7 +50,7 @@ export default {
{label: '认缴出资(万)', prop: 'department'},
{label: '实缴出资额', prop: 'department'},
{label: '认缴出资额', prop: 'department'},
{label: '参股日期', prop: 'department'}
{label: '参股日期', prop: 'department', width: '150'}
],
formData: [],
//列表
......@@ -62,13 +62,13 @@ export default {
}
},
created() {
this.dataRegion()
this.handleData()
},
methods: {
handleClick(){
this.dataRegion()
this.handleData()
},
async dataRegion() {
async handleData() {
this.tableData = [
{id:1, inReason:'达萨法达萨法', inDate:'000',tag:'aaa'},
{id:2, inReason:'达萨法达萨法', inDate:'111'},
......
......@@ -17,6 +17,18 @@
:queryParams="queryParams"
@handle-current-change="handleCurrentChange"
>
<template slot="gqzb">
<div class="tab-header">股权占比 <el-popover
placement="top-start"
width="280"
trigger="hover">
<div>
控股67%:绝对控制权67%,相当于100%的权力,修改公司章程/分立、合并、变更主营项目、重大决策<br />
控股51%:相对控制权51%,控制线,绝对控制公司<br />
控股34%:安全控制权,一票否决权</div>
<img src="@/assets/images/detail/overview/zbph_question.png" slot="reference">
</el-popover></div>
</template>
<template slot="inReason" slot-scope="scope">
<div>{{scope.row.inReason}}</div>
<div class="tags" v-if="scope.row.tag">
......@@ -32,6 +44,7 @@
import mixin from '../mixins/mixin'
export default {
name: 'Overseas',
props: ['companyId'],
mixins: [mixin],
data() {
return {
......@@ -45,7 +58,7 @@ export default {
{label: '法定代表人', prop: 'inDate'},
{label: '注册资本(万元)', prop: 'department'},
{label: '成立日期', prop: 'department'},
{label: '股权占比', prop: 'department'},
{label: '股权占比', prop: 'department', slotHeader: true, slotName: 'gqzb'},
{label: '认缴出资额(万元)', prop: 'department'}
],
formData: [
......@@ -75,10 +88,10 @@ export default {
}
},
created() {
this.dataRegion()
this.handleData()
},
methods: {
async dataRegion() {
async handleData() {
this.tableData = [
{id:1, inReason:'达萨法达萨法', inDate:'000',tag:'aaa'},
{id:2, inReason:'达萨法达萨法', inDate:'111'},
......@@ -98,6 +111,14 @@ export default {
margin: 0;
padding: 16px;
background: #FFFFFF;
.tab-header{
img{
margin-bottom: -3px;
width: 14px;
height: 14px;
cursor: pointer;
}
}
.tags{
.tag{
display: inline-block;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ment